wake-up-neo.net

Download del codice da Google Code senza utilizzare un sistema di controllo della versione

Esiste un metodo per scaricare una cartella da Google Code senza dover utilizzare il sistema di controllo versione?

14
Casebash

Da quale piattaforma?

Da Linux, se il repository di codice è Subversion, puoi fare qualcosa del tipo:

wget -m http://fofix.googlecode.com/svn/MFH-Mod/trunk/

C'è un avvertimento non così piccolo a quel comando, che scaricherà l'intero repository sull'unità (ovvero tutti i tag e i rami più il trunk).

Un altro approccio sta usando lftp:

lftp http://fofix.googlecode.com/svn/MFH-Mod/trunk/
lftp fofix.googlecode.com:/svn/MFH-Mod/trunk>
lftp fofix.googlecode.com:/svn/MFH-Mod/trunk>mirror <directory to download>

E questo scaricherà solo quella directory, ricorsivamente.

Da Windows ci sono alcune app di mirroring, ma non posso raccomandarne una specifica.

16
feniix

Stavo cercando la stessa cosa. Il prossimo approccio migliore potrebbe essere l'uso del seguente eseguibile standalone minimalista per Windows (solo ~ 8,45 KB): http://downloadsvn.codeplex.com/

È molto meglio che dover installare un sistema di controllo versione SVN o GIT standard (dovresti avere installato .NET Framework). Anche se questo è un vecchio post, spero che sia di aiuto.

9
sagunms

So che questo è un post piuttosto vecchio, ma per le persone che arrivano qui googling, voglio dire, che puoi scaricare il trunk pulito invece dell'intero repository con wget utilizzando questo indirizzo:

[project_name_here].googlecode.com/svn/trunk

Invece di:

code.google.com/p/[project_name_here]/source/browse/trunk
3
nucular

Molti progetti hanno una scheda "Download" in cui offrono il codice sorgente in un file Zip. Questo potrebbe essere il modo più semplice per accedere a una versione specifica del codice. Per quanto riguarda l'accesso al repository live potresti essere sfortunato.

2
Joe Phillips